FALLS DOWN STEPS
DIES OF INJURIES
Mrs. Bowie Was Born In Frederick County--Burial At Unionville
Mrs. Catherine Gaither Bowie, wife of Col. Washington Bowie, Sr., died Saturday night at Mercy Hospital Baltimore from the effects of a fall down a flight of stairs. She had been at the hospital since Friday.
Mrs. Bowie was a member of a prominent Maryland family, as is her husband, Colonel Bowie. She was a daughter of the late George Gaither and was born in Frederick county. Colonel and Mrs. Bowie resided at 1403 Madison avenue, Baltimore.
Besides her husband, Mrs. Bowie is survived by three brothers, Mr. Jesse S. Gaither, of New York; Mr. Robert Lee Gaither, of Manassas, Va., and William Gaither, of Baltimore and two sisters, Mrs. Joseph B. Boyle and Miss Fannie Cross Gaither of New York.
Col. Washington Bowie, Jr., who is now at the Mexican border with the Maryland National Guard is a stepson.
Colonel Bowie, Sr., was at one time prominent in Democratic circles and held a number of important offices. For some years he has not been active in politics.
The funeral of Mrs. Bowie will be held Tuesday and the burial will be at Unionville, Frederick county.
